Tips for Navigating Berlin’s Nightlife

  • A proper planning of your evening requires research to determine the most appealing clubs and venues.
  • Before entering clubs you should arrive early because many restrictions enforce appropriate dress policies resulting in long entry queues.
  • Businesses with smaller bars or clubs operate using cash transactions only so always bring cash for payments.
  • Public transportation along with taxi services are the best choices for getting from venue to venue since parking spots remain scarce while having designated drivers reduces risks.
  • Treat club culture with reverence together with the surrounding individuals. The nightlife environment in Berlin welcomes all people with its accepting attitudes.
